A useful diagnostic point is to check the high-voltage DC bus on the bulk capacitor. If there is 325V DC present, but there is no output on the secondary side, the issue is likely on the primary switching side (e.g., the PWM controller, the MOSFET, or the transformer) or the secondary rectification. If this voltage is missing, the problem is in the AC input or primary rectification stages. If the voltage is low, the bulk capacitor may be failing.

This is the "heart" of the switching power supply. The high-voltage DC bus is connected to a , which acts as a fast, electronic switch. This MOSFET is turned on and off at a high frequency, typically around 25 kHz for the S-360 series.
